The Ford Galaxy is a segment leader, outselling its nearest competitor, the Volkswagen Sharan, five to one.

Last year the Ford MPV sold around 8000 models, with more than 80% going to fleets. The revised model, on sale last month, will bring more sales says Ford, although no official forecasts have been announced.

There’s no reduction in CO2 on the facelift, but it still falls below the notable 160g/km bracket for fleets, with BIK of 23%.

The mid-range trim Zetec in partnership with the 139hp 2.0-litre diesel engine will be the most popular fleet model, costing £24,285 and offering a cost per mile of 55.5p.

Prices for the Galaxy range from between £2000-£3000 less than the outgoing model, says Ford.

Currently, automatic transmission accounts for 35% of Galaxy’s fleet sales, below the segment norm of 50%. However, with Ford introducing its Powershift dual-clutch transmission to its large car range, sales are expected to move in line with the overall trend.

The facelift means a more sculpted bonnet as well as new fog and LED tail lights. High series models get more chrome detailing on side mouldings and door handles.

Interior-wise, Ford’s fold-flat seat system comes as standard and a “premium” sound system with upgraded speakers and subwoofer is an option.

There is ample room for seven people with an array of compartments to hide away stuff, as well as mirrors that allow drivers to see what kids are up to in the back, dual-zone air conditioning, front and rear parking assist, and lights for first- and second-row occupants.

Any Ford vehicle is hard to fault in terms of ride and drive quality and the same applies with the latest Galaxy. It handles like a much smaller car with good suspension and road presence, and has plenty of torque despite being a large MPV.

As the figures suggests, its hard to beat the Galaxy in this sector – but despite cost reductions, you’ll still pay a premium for the goods.

Ford Galazy 2.0 Zetec TDCi 140hp
P11D price £24,260
Model price range £22,945-29,545
Fuel consumption 47.1mpg
CO2 (tax) 159g/km/(23%)
BIK 20/40% per month £93/£186
Service interval 12,500mls
Insurance group 20
Warranty 3yrs/60,000mls
Boot space (min/max) 308/2325 litres
Engine size/power 1997cc/140hp
Top speed/0-62mph 120mph/10.1secs
On sale April 2010
